What was filmed in Vršovice?
1 production is recorded as filmed in Vršovice, including Extraction 2 (2023). 1 of the credits come from Wikipedia articles rather than Wikidata statements and are labelled per Wikipedia.
Where is Vršovice?
Vršovice is in the Czech Republic. Its coordinates are 50.0644, 14.4525.
